Ariana Grande seemingly asked her fans to stop attacking her ex-husband Dalton Gomez over the lyrics of her new song, 'Eternal Sunshine'.

Eternal Sunshine was named after Jim Carey and Kate Winslet's 2004 film, Eternal Sunshine of the Spotless Mind, which follows a couple that breaks up and decides to forget about each other through a medical procedure. Fans started hitting out at the singer's ex on Friday morning when the song was released.

The lyrics say: "I've never seen someone lie like you do, so much even you start to think it's true. Get me out of this loop, yeah, yeah. So now we play our separate scenes. Now, now she's in my bed, mm-mm, layin' on your chest. Now I'm in my head, wonderin' how it ends."

But the social media attacks went a bit too far, according to Ariana, who asked her fans to stop sending "hateful messages" based on their interpretation of her new album. She wrote on her Instagram stories: "Hi, I just wanted to say, anyone that is sending hateful messages to the people in my life based on your interpretation of this album is not supporting me and is absolutely doing the polar opposite of what I would ever encourage (and is also entireli misinterpreting the intention behind the music)... I ask that you please do not.

"It is not how to support me. It is the opposite. Although this album captures a lot of painful moments, it also is woven together with a through line of deep, sincere love. If you cannot hear that, please listen more closely. Thank you. I love you!!!"

While she did not mention her ex-husband Dalton explicitly, it seems the message was about him since he received so much hate online over the past couple of days. Ariana and Dalton got engaged in December 2020. The couple tied the knot at an intimate ceremony at their Montecito home in May 2021 but sadly went their separate ways after less than two years of marriage. It was all over almost as quickly as it had begun and Ariana filed for divorce in September 2023.
